Summary
A studio portrait of a man identified as Seth Kinman. The bearded man wears pants, boots, an animal hide coat with fringes, bear claw belt and a head band. He leans against a rifle.

Notes
Photographer's seal printed on back of photoprint.; Title, "who presented President Lincoln with the Elk Horn Chair" and "Entered according to Act of Congress by Seth Kinman, in the year 1864, in the Clerks Office of the District Court of the District of Columbia" printed on front of photoprint.; R7110024617
